Job Description:
 

This is a Regional Role, overseeing Planning and Development projects across the Country.  The Director will manage a coordinator and a team of outsourced Planners for the Western Region

Provide Planning and Development assistance to the Legal, Real Estate and Construction Departments as part of the Due Diligence process for prospective land transactions.  This typically involves the determination of Municipal requirements (zoning, development fees, off-site costs, restrictions, etc.) and the development of a preliminary design drawings and the review of potential agreements.
Manage the design and Municipal approval process for new stores, renovations, conversions, and ancillary developments in Canada. 

 

Responsibilities:

  • Assemble the appropriate team of consultants (Planning, Traffic, Civil Engineers, Surveyor, Landscape, Architectural and additional consultants based on specific job-related issues) to prepare municipal submission applications
  • Create initial design drawings in conjunction with the consulting team
  • Determination of Planning and Development approvals strategy
  • Co-ordination and execution of all Municipal applications
  • Engage with Municipal Staff, Politicians and Local Ratepayers
  • Make Presentations to Municipal Committees and Council as required in order to advance applications
  • Negotiate the details of all required on-site and off-site municipal approvals with Municipal Staff (Official Plan Amendments, Rezoning's, Minor Variance)
  • Contribute to and review the preparation of legal municipal agreements (Development Agreements, Site Plan Approval, Subdivision Agreement)
  • Provide support during the Building Permit review process in order to ensure that all Municipal requirements are addressed, and a permit is issued in a timely matter
  • Liase with the Construction Department during the development phase in order to guarantee that the project is completed as per Municipal approval
  • Coordinate with the Construction Department, contractor, civil engineer and the municipality the implementation of all off-site infrastructure improvements
  • Assist the Construction Department during the preparation of all project budgets (A1's, CE3's) particularly with the provision of costs related to municipal requirements (development charges/ levies, building permit fees, off-site costs, landscape requirements, etc.)
  • Liase with the Real Estate Department to ensure that all Vendor or Landlord commitments are realized during the development phase.
  • Manage Consultant resources in order to ensure efficiency and the delivery of the Capital Plan
